Psednos harteli Chernova, 2001 Hartel's dwarf snailfish |
| Family: | Liparidae (Snailfishes) | |||
| Max. size: | 4.8 cm SL (male/unsexed) | |||
| Environment: | bathydemersal; marine; depth range 0 - 1008 m | |||
| Distribution: | Northwest Atlantic: above the continental slope of eastern North America. | |||
| Diagnosis: | Dorsal soft rays (total): 42-42; Anal soft rays: 35-35; Vertebrae: 47-47. No coronal pore, io 6 (5+1), 6 preoperculo-mandibular pores and 1 suprabranchial pore; lower pectoral lobe wide and thick, handlike, 1 pectoral notch ray, gill slit distinctly oblique and short (about equal to eye), large mouth (cleft reaching to below pupil, upper jaw 13.5% SL), caudal part of body unpigmented. | |||
